Hayfield boys win the weekend The Vikings looked good on the hardcourt last week. On Friday, Hayfield defeated Waterville-Elysian-Morristown, 73-55. Saturday’s action saw the Vikings overwhelm Springfield, 83-53. WEM Game: Hayfield Stats: Zander Jacobson, 18 points, 11 rebounds, 2 assists, 3 steals...

Byron girls gymnasts traveled to Worthington on Saturday, January 28, to compete in the True Team State Meet and came away finishing fifth out of ten of the top teams in the state. In this meet, all five girls counted in the team score versus the normal four. Individuals received scores, but only...
Dodge County’s girls’ hockey team now stands at 14-7-1, with just a couple of regular season games remaining. On Tuesday, January 24, the girls lost to Lakeville South, 3-0, at Hasse Arena. The Wildcats battled Moose Lake to a 1-1 overtime tie on Friday, at Riverside Ice Arena. Saturday saw the DC...

Westfield Razorbacks wrestled at Hayfield on Thursday, January 26. They went 1-1 as a team on the day, beating Saint Clair-Mankato Loyola, 58-18, and losing to Kenyon-Wanamingo, 61-15.
